WWT will use innovative technology to enhance event experience for athletes, coaches and fans

ST. LOUIS: Global technology solutions provider World Wide Technology (WWT) announced today it will serve as an official sponsor of the 2026 Special Olympics USA Games and will develop a new and innovative mobile application for the competition called “The Champions” app. Additionally, WWT employees will have the opportunity to volunteer locally and at the 2026 USA Games.

The 2026 Special Olympics USA Games, to be held in Minnesota from June 20-26, 2026, is set to be one of the largest sporting events in the U.S. next year, uniting thousands of athletes, heads of delegations, coaches, volunteers and fans from all 50 states to shine a light on the abilities and strengths of people with intellectual disabilities. WWT will create a cutting-edge application designed to enhance the overall event experience for participants and attendees, with features to advance scoring systems, streamline event navigation and scheduling, boost engagement and personalize the experience for each user.

"On behalf of WWT, it is an honor to be involved in the 2026 Special Olympics USA Games in a way that holds great significance for both organizations," said Josh Hogan, Vice President and General Manager of Digital and AI Solutions at WWT. “We’re proud to bring WWT’s expertise in AI and digital innovation to the 2026 Special Olympics USA Games. By leveraging cutting-edge technology, we’re creating a more personalized, inclusive and seamless experience for athletes, coaches and fans alike.”

"We are incredibly grateful for WWT's partnership in helping to bring the 2026 Special Olympics USA Games to life as both a sponsor and technology partner," said Christy Sovereign, Chief Executive Officer of the 2026 Special Olympics USA Games. "Their commitment extends beyond sponsorship, empowering us with the technology to create an exceptional and lasting experience for our athletes and the entire community."

About Special Olympics USA Games

The 2026 Special Olympics USA Games—scheduled for June 20-26, 2026, across Minnesota’s Twin Cities with sports competitions at the University of Minnesota and the National Sports Center in Blaine—is a national celebration of inclusivity, changing perceptions and the ability of the human spirit rising above limitations. The USA Games, with co-presenting partners Jersey Mike’s Subs and United Healthcare, will be one of the biggest U.S. sporting events of the year, drawing tens of thousands of fans to celebrate the ability of over 3,000 incredible athletes from all 50 states as they compete in 16 Olympic-type team and individual sports. As a state with a long history of championing inclusion, the USA Games now bring an unrivaled opportunity to Minnesota to spark new energy around the Special Olympics movement and create a lasting legacy of positive change.
